The Atlantic Community School Board has taken decisive action, terminating a staff member amidst serious allegations, even as the police investigation remains ongoing. But here's where it gets controversial: should an employee face professional consequences before the legal process concludes? The board's decision followed a heated meeting where emotions ran high, with parents and community members seeking transparency regarding claims of inappropriate conduct involving students. The Atlantic Police Department continues to investigate these allegations, which first came to light on January 18 when a concerned parent contacted the district. In response, the school placed the staff member on administrative leave, a move that underscores the gravity of the situation. While the staff member's identity remains undisclosed due to the absence of formal charges, the case raises critical questions about due process and the responsibility of educational institutions to act swiftly in safeguarding their students.
